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S933544AbdC3MFm (ORCPT ); Thu, 30 Mar 2017 08:05:42 -0400 Received: from smtprelay4.synopsys.com ([198.182.47.9]:45744 "EHLO smtprelay.synopsys.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S933469AbdC3MFl (ORCPT ); Thu, 30 Mar 2017 08:05:41 -0400 From: Eugeniy Paltsev To: "dri-devel@lists.freedesktop.org" CC: "daniel@ffwll.ch" , "linux-kernel@vger.kernel.org" , "linux-snps-arc@lists.infradead.org" , "airlied@linux.ie" Subject: DRM: Component framework API support Thread-Topic: Component framework API support Thread-Index: AQHSqU3gtL283uk2GUiXcUn8G9jWJw== Date: Thu, 30 Mar 2017 12:05:08 +0000 Message-ID: <1490875508.6561.11.camel@synopsys.com>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-originating-ip: [10.121.8.111] Content-Type: text/plain; charset="utf-8" Content-ID: MIME-Version: 1.0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Transfer-Encoding: 8bit X-MIME-Autoconverted: from base64 to 8bit by mail.home.local id v2UC7Wxq027557 Content-Length: 433 Lines: 10 Hi, I am trying to add support of new component framework API in ARC PGU driver. The point is that for now we have ARC PGU driver which works with adv7511 encoder. Both of them don't support component framework API. I had to add support of component framework based dw_hdmi encoder to ARC PGU driver. So what is best way of implementing both component framework API and regular API in one driver? Thanks. --  Eugeniy Paltsev